Output 26e4ad34ead371aaacb0c5a0da1c23049b27aeefeaa1059d206fb78cba9b2eea:45

value
950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a482c3923d8e1ab9c8a80e5afb85fc547b2720 OP_EQUAL
address
358413yFdPyd4hoFQ1EBbAEko2FLxyakp3
transaction
26e4ad34ead371aaacb0c5a0da1c23049b27aeefeaa1059d206fb78cba9b2eea
spent
true